Due to our Upstate NY winters with road salt, common repairs include brake system corrosion, exhaust component rust, and suspension wear from potholes. For Toyotas specifically, we frequently service hybrid battery systems in Prius models and address oil consumption issues in certain older 4-cylinder engines.
Look for shops in the greater Syracuse/Warners area that are ASE-certified and have technicians with specific Toyota or T-TEN training. Checking for strong online reviews and asking if they use genuine Toyota parts or high-quality OEM equivalents is also crucial for reliable repairs.
Typically, yes, dealership labor rates are higher, but they offer manufacturer-trained technicians and guaranteed genuine parts. Independent shops in the Warners area often provide competitive pricing and personalized service, so it's wise to get written estimates from both for non-warranty repairs.
Seek immediate service if you notice reduced braking performance, hear unusual noises from the suspension, or see the check engine or traction control lights illuminate. These issues are safety-critical on our icy, salted roads and can lead to more extensive damage if ignored.
Follow the "severe service" schedule in your manual due to stop-and-go Syracuse traffic and harsh winters. Prioritize seasonal services like undercarriage washes to fight rust and timely tire changes, as Baldwinsville Road and other local routes require good all-season or winter tires for safety.
